Compare all specifications:
1972 De Tomaso Pantera | 1992 Volvo 245 | |
Make | De Tomaso | Volvo |
Model | Pantera | 245 |
Year Released | 1972 | 1992 |
Engine Position | Middle | Front |
Engine Size | 5761 cc | 1986 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Horse Power | 350 HP | 116 HP |
Engine RPM | 5400 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 525 Nm | 157 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3400 RPM | 4500 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 101.6 mm | 88.9 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 88.9 mm | 80 mm |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Length | 4280 mm | 4790 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1840 mm | 1730 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1110 mm | 1470 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2520 mm | 2660 mm |
